Warning Signs You Need Foundation Leak Water Removal

Ignoring foundation leaks can lead to serious consequences, including costly repairs, water damage, and even health risks.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show a hidden leak or water damage. This is especially true if the smell is coming from a specific area of your home, such as a basement or crawlspace.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. Look for discoloration, warping, or sagging in your walls or ceilings.

Cracks in Walls or Floors

Cracks can be a sign of structural damage or shifting foundations. This can be a sign of a larger issue, including foundation leaks.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Unusual noises, such as creaking, groaning, or dripping sounds, can show a hidden leak or water damage.

High Water Bills

High water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ak or water waste. This can be especially true if your bills have increased suddenly or without explanation.

Water Damage or Flooding

Visible water damage or flooding can be a sign of a more serious issue, including foundation leaks.

Foundation Leak Water Removal Cost In Lake Jackson, TX

The cost of foundation le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lake Jackson,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ges to exp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ency response $500 - $2,500 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area
Water removal $1,000 - $5,000 Size of the affected area, amount of water involved
Drying and inspection $500 - $2,000 Size of the affected area, complexity of the issue
Repair and restoration $2,000 - $10,000 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area
Final inspection and cleanup $500 - $2,000 Size of the affected area, complexity of the issue

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ment by our team. We offer free estimates and will work with you to develop a plan that meets your needs and budget.
